jPdf Tweak

jPdf Tweak

Office & Productivity Desktop Application
jPdf Tweak is a versatile, cross-platform Java Swing application designed for manipulating PDF files. It offers a range of functionalities including combining, splitting, rotating, reordering, watermarking, encrypting, signing, and other essential PDF adjustments.
more
Open Source
Free and open source (GPLv3 license).
